Compartilhar via


Como: Desfazer um operação de refatoração de banco de dados

Este tópico explica como desfazer as alterações após aplicar um ou mais objetos de banco de dados de operações de refatoração de banco de dados. Por exemplo, se você renomear uma coluna em uma tabela, qualquer procedimento armazenado que fazem referência a essa coluna é atualizado automaticamente com o novo nome. Para obter mais informações, consulte Refatorar o código do banco de dados e dados.

Você pode usar a funcionalidade de desfazer global para desfazer as alterações depois de aplicar qualquer uma das operações de refatoração de banco de dados. Você pode desfazer as alterações para o objeto de esquema e todas as referências ao objeto que foram atualizadas automaticamente. Essas atualizações são desfeitas em uma transação, e todos os arquivos que são atualizados pela operação de desfazer são salvos, mesmo que eles sejam fechados durante a operação de desfazer.

ObservaçãoObservação

Você pode executar a operação de desfazer somente se todos os planos de geração de dados afetados são fechados. Para obter mais informações, consulte Solucionando problemas de geração de dados.

Para desfazer uma operação de refatoração de renomeação

  • Sobre o Editar menu, clique em Desfazer Global.

    O texto da opção de menu inclui os detalhes da operação que será desfeita. Por exemplo, o menu pode dizer Desfazer Global * renomear de DataDeEnvio para ShippedDateAndTime. Você também pode clicar a Desfazer na barra de ferramentas. Se você clicar na seta suspensa no botão, aparecem os detalhes da operação que será desfeita.

    Se nenhuma operação pode ser desfeita, o comando será desativado e exibir o texto Desfazer última ação Global.

    ObservaçãoObservação

    Você também pode refazer operações usando Refazer Global.

Consulte também

Tarefas

Como: Renomear objetos de banco de dados

Demonstra Passo a passo: Aplicar as técnicas de refatoração de banco de dados

Como: Implantar alterações de refatoração de banco de dados

Conceitos

Renomear todas as referências a um objeto de banco de dados

Refatorar o código do banco de dados e dados